Spring Field Hockey (Girls)
These programs offer an opportunity for beginning field hockey players to learn and develop skills and for the more experienced players to be taught the more advanced skills that they will need for their school teams. These programs will feature highly qualified local coaches. 
All field hockey programs will take place at Clifton Common in front of the ice arena. Field hockey equipment will be available to rent on the opening day of each camp for a small fee. All girls will need a stick and shin guards. Mouth guards are required and will be on sale for $6. A security deposit is required for all equipment rentals.
 
Learn-to-Play - Grades K-3
This program is for beginners and is set in a fun, hands-on and positive environment. The emphasis is on fun!
Girls Beginner/Novice - Grades 4-10
This program is for girls who are beginner or novice players who need to sharpen their basic skills while being introduced to more advanced techniques.
Girls Intermediate/Advanced - Grades 8-12
This program is for intermediate & advanced skill level players who have been playing field hockey for a while and have a good deal of skill. These players want to refine their skills while being introduced to more advanced techniques.

Learn-to-Fish Day
NYS Department of Environmental Conservation staff will be present helping with fish identification, equipment, techniques and education about fisheries management, angling ethics and aquatic ecology. This is a free, public, sport fishing event with no freshwater fishing license required if participating in the event.
Fishing gear will be available to borrow during the event.  You may bring your own poles if you have them.

Pickleball 101 Plus
Come and learn the fun sport of Pickleball, the fastest growing sport in North America! Week 1 - Focus will be on giving you the skills necessary to get started playing doubles Pickleball. You'll learn the basic game overview, serving, and returning the ball. Week 2 - We will dive into the roles of the serving team, returning team, play games and keep score. Paddles and ballas are provided. This program is for beginners with no experience. Each class will last approximately 1 1/2 hours.
